As Los Angeles faces its most destructive wildfires in history, tens of thousands of buildings have been destroyed, and hundreds of thousands have been forced to flee their homes.
The largest blaze, in the Pacific Palisades area, has burned more than 23,000 acres, making it the city’s worst fire on record.
To grasp the scale, the affected area stretches across large parts of lower Manhattan and Queens in New York.
In this BBC News special, we hear from those on the front line and the people who have lost their homes and livelihoods to the disaster.
